Transaction 5b76fa701b20fd9c6cbdae8b6c3379d51b85ea6ec76fc8d77a60179d3a09ff6f
3 Input
2 Outputs
- 5b76fa701b20fd9c6cbdae8b6c3379d51b85ea6ec76fc8d77a60179d3a09ff6f:0
- 5b76fa701b20fd9c6cbdae8b6c3379d51b85ea6ec76fc8d77a60179d3a09ff6f:1
value 7355383
address 14Z63y5MHaVRPZTsyeXxPFYyZng4TUQDpD
value 181353291
address 3DR8qJdAC5LuTUSZsfyxtZrpVubM3GV93g